Output 34469385c965344ac314e899de7e9464a78c51e7320ece21d83eba695e2fbaaa:5

value
603208650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 269827738b2aca7cf75c5e9781f3953ec11e88da OP_EQUALVERIFY OP_CHECKSIG
address
14X4x9FUXeY24VfEuxZqdUk51sNiEWvrBR
transaction
34469385c965344ac314e899de7e9464a78c51e7320ece21d83eba695e2fbaaa
spent
true